You as an Operations Director will: Play a key role in supporting the Texas Regional Manager and leadership team while driving initiatives to establish a strong presence in the Texas market. Foster a collaborative and positive work environment that emphasizes caring for both our business and the safety of our team and community. Identify and secure construction projects across Central Texas. Effectively staff all Central Texas projects with dynamic & professional individuals that reflect the company's values. Assist the E stimating Manager and the Pre-construction Director with comprehensive bid reviews and tender closings, drawing on specific market and industry knowledge. Develop comprehensive project execution plans, including pre - construction , estimating, project scheduling, and risk mitigation strategies. Hold teams accountable for all aspects of project performance. Lead and mentor construction site leaders (Superintendents, Project Managers , etc ., to ensure decisions are made with safety, integrity, and sound business practices in mind. Build and maintain strong relationships with clients, subcontractors, and partners, embodying trust and fairness in every interaction. Is this the right role for you? Proven experience in managing medium and large construction projects in the Central Texas market. Strong leadership skills focused on team collaboration, business care, and safety. A passion for building and expanding EllisDon 's business in Texas, creating opportunities for all team members. A c ommitment to innovation and excellence in every project. Established relationships with Central Texas clients, subcontractors and trade partners. Bachelor's degree in construction management, engineering or related field. A degree from a Texas University is a plus. 1 5 + years construction experience . A proven record of delivering Health Care and Higher Education projects is a plus.
